§ 8-207. Federal qualification by issuance of shares without consideration.
 

Notwithstanding any other provision of the Maryland REIT Law, a real estate investment trust may issue shares of beneficial interest without consideration for the purpose of qualifying the real estate investment trust as a real estate investment trust under the Internal Revenue Code. 
 

[2000, ch. 642; 2005, ch. 586.]
